What is ERP Order Management?

ERP order management refers to the process of managing and fulfilling customer orders within an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) system. It involves the end-to-end handling of orders, from the creation and processing to the fulfillment and delivery.

With ERP order management, businesses can efficiently track and manage their orders, ensuring accurate and timely delivery to customers. It provides a centralized platform where all order-related information is stored, allowing for seamless coordination across departments.

Key Features of ERP Order Management

1. Order Creation and Processing: ERP order management enables businesses to easily create and process customer orders. This includes generating order forms, capturing customer details, and managing order approvals.

2. Inventory and Stock Control: An important aspect of ERP order management is inventory and stock control. It allows businesses to track their product availability, monitor stock levels, and automatically update inventory data in real-time.

3. Order Fulfillment and Tracking: ERP order management streamlines the order fulfillment process by facilitating efficient picking, packing, and shipping. Additionally, it provides order tracking capabilities, allowing both businesses and customers to monitor the status and shipment of orders.

4. Customer Relationship Management (CRM) Integration: ERP order management often integrates with CRM systems, providing businesses with a comprehensive view of their customers. This integration allows for better customer communication, personalized service, and improved customer satisfaction.

Evaluating Your Business Requirements

In order to choose the right ERP order management system, you must first evaluate your business requirements. Take into consideration the size of your business, the volume of orders you handle, and the complexity of your supply chain. This assessment will help you determine what features and functionalities you need in an ERP order management system.

  • Assess the size of your business and the number of orders you process daily: This will help you identify the scalability requirements of the ERP system you choose.
  • Consider the complexity of your supply chain: If you have multiple sales channels, warehouses, or global operations, you’ll need an ERP system that can handle these complexities.
  • Analyze your current order management processes: Identify the pain points and areas for improvement in your current system. This will help you prioritize the features you need in a new ERP system.

Leveraging Data Migration and Integration

One of the critical steps in implementing ERP order management is effectively migrating and integrating your data. This process ensures that your existing data is seamlessly transferred to the new system, enabling smooth operations and accurate reporting.

Assess your data: Analyze your current data sources, including spreadsheets, databases, and other systems. Determine what data is essential for order management and identify any potential gaps or inconsistencies.

Plan for migration: Develop a comprehensive data migration plan that outlines the necessary steps, timelines, and responsibilities. Consider factors such as data cleansing, validation, and mapping to ensure the integrity of your information.

Integrate with existing systems: Evaluate the integration requirements between the ERP order management system and your other business systems, such as CRM or inventory management. Ensure seamless data flow and avoid duplicate data entry.

Automating Order Processing

With ERP order management, you can automate order processing, saving time and reducing errors. The system can automatically generate and send invoices, update inventory levels, and track shipments. This not only speeds up the order fulfillment process, but also ensures accuracy and consistency across all orders. ✅

Inventory and Warehouse Management

Efficiently managing inventory and warehouse operations is crucial for a successful business. ERP order management provides real-time visibility into stock levels, allowing you to keep track of available products, anticipate demand, and avoid stockouts. It also helps optimize warehouse layouts and streamline picking, packing, and shipping processes. With these capabilities, you can maintain optimal inventory levels and improve overall warehouse efficiency. ✨
